The short answer

EcoFlow DELTA Max 2000 costs $700 less. Whether that gap is worth closing depends on what you need to run.

⚠️ Before you buy

If you plan to cycle the battery daily, think twice about the EcoFlow DELTA Max 2000. Its NMC cells are rated for 800 cycles against the LiFePO4 rival's longer life — over years of regular use that's the more expensive unit, whatever the sticker says.

EcoFlow DELTA 3 Ultra

3kWh with 7200W surge at $1799 — this is whole-home territory at a mid-range price. The catch is the 800W solar input.

Best for: Grid-tied home backup where you recharge from the wall, not the sun.

Where it falls short:

  • 800W solar input is low for 3kWh — slow off-grid refills
  • 83.8 lb
EcoFlow DELTA Max 2000

The previous-generation 2kWh EcoFlow. Still capable and expandable, but its NMC cells and 800-cycle rating are a real step below the LiFePO4 DELTA 3 that replaced it.

Best for: Only at a steep discount against the DELTA 3 Max.

Where it falls short:

  • NMC — roughly 800 cycles vs 4,000 for the DELTA 3 Max
  • 2-year warranty
SpecEcoFlow DELTA 3 UltraEcoFlow DELTA Max 2000
Price $1799 $1099
Capacity 3072 Wh 2016 Wh
Continuous output 3600 W 2400 W
Surge output 7200 W 3400 W
Battery LiFePO4 NMC
Rated cycles 4,000 800
Weight (lighter wins) 83.8 lb 48 lb
Max solar 800 W 800 W
Recharge time (faster wins) 1h 30m 1h 48m

Runtime head-to-head

ApplianceEcoFlow DELTA 3 UltraEcoFlow DELTA Max 2000
Refrigerator43.5 hrs28.6 hrs
Mini fridge82.9 hrs54.4 hrs
Chest freezer32.6 hrs21.4 hrs
CPAP machine65.3 hrs42.8 hrs
Sump pump3.3 hrs2.1 hrs
